Presynaptic protein involved in the synaptic transmission tuning. Regulates synaptic release probability by decreasing the calcium sensitivity of release.

Protein Aliases: family with sequence similarity 79, member A; Mossy fiber terminal-associated vertebrate-specific presynaptic protein; mossy fiber terminal-associated vertebrate-specific presynaptic protein {ECO:0000312|EMBL:ABW83994.1}; mossy-fiber terminal-associated vertebrate-specific presynaptic protein; Protein FAM79A; RP11-46F15.3; synaptic vesicle associated protein of 30 kD; tprg1l {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q5T0D9}; Tumor protein p63-regulated gene 1-like protein; tumor protein p63-regulated gene 1-like protein {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q5T0D9}
Gene Aliases: 1200015A19Rik; FAM79A; h-mover; MOVER; Svap30; TPRG1L; Tprgl
UniProt ID: (Human) Q5T0D9, (Rat) A8WCF8, (Mouse) Q9DBS2
Entrez Gene ID: (Human) 127262, (Rat) 687090, (Mouse) 67808
